A nineteenth-century Scottish ram's horn snuff mull with white metal mounts and faceted yellow gemstone
Description
A Scottish ram’s horn snuff mull of traditional form, featuring a naturally curved horn with a dark, polished finish. The wide end of the horn is fitted with a white metal mount and a hinged lid, which is inset with a large, faceted yellow gemstone. The tip of the horn is capped with a white metal terminal mount. The interior of the wide end is hollowed to create a compartment for snuff. A handwritten white adhesive label is affixed to the lid, reading 12850 over P. A printed adhesive auction tag is attached to the metal mount near the hinge, reading SHELBYS AUCTIONEERS, LOT 256, and 01132502626. No hallmarks are visible on the metal mounts in the provided images.
